The Dickson Poon School of Law is recognised globally as one of the UK’s premier law schools with a community of nearly 900 undergraduate students from around the globe.

Our teaching is led by internationally respected, leading academics, visiting lecturers and practitioners from global law firms. Our academic staff and their expertise are regularly called upon to advise governments, serve on commissions and public bodies and help to shape policy and practice nationally and internationally. The courses we offer are informed by our research expertise and you are encouraged to engage with issues at the cutting-edge of your studies, giving you the skills and confidence to engage with complex legal issues and global challenges.

We support our students with a range of pastoral care and student wellbeing initiatives including a peer-to-peer support network run for students by students. You are assigned a Personal Tutor for each year of your course and all tutors have weekly feedback, support and advice hours. The university also runs an array of services that you can access including counselling, mental health and funding support.

When you study as an undergraduate with us in The Dickson Poon School of Law there are some international courses that you apply to directly via UCAS and some that you can elect to study only once you have enrolled on our LLB.

Before you arrive: apply through UCAS

UCAS Code: M121
Duration: Four years

Study for a LLB and Maîtrise en droit (Master 1) English Law & French Law degree at The Dickson Poon School of Law at King's College London.
